Abstract
A method and a system for rapid kinetic fluorescence measurement in high-throughput screening with high time-resolution includes providing a microtiter plate having a transparent base and multiple assay wells, a dispensing system arranged above the microtiter plate for simultaneously adding liquid into multiple assay wells, an illumination system beneath the microtiter plate for illuminating the multiple assay wells simultaneously through the transparent base, a detection system for detecting electromagnetic radiation from the multiple assay wells simultaneously through the transparent base, adding 0.3-300 μl of liquid per assay well from the dispensing system into the multiple assay wells, illuminating the multiple assay wells simultaneously through the transparent base using the illumination system before or from the time point of the start of the addition, detecting the electromagnetic radiation from the multiple assay wells simultaneously at a time interval of 1-1000 ms between individual measurement points.
